mercurial/hgweb/common.py
changeset 30625 bcf4a975f93d
parent 30615 bb77654dc7ae
child 30636 f1c9fafcbf46
equal deleted inserted replaced
30624:a82a6eee2613 30625:bcf4a975f93d
   141     """
   141     """
   142     parts = fname.split('/')
   142     parts = fname.split('/')
   143     for part in parts:
   143     for part in parts:
   144         if (part in ('', os.curdir, os.pardir) or
   144         if (part in ('', os.curdir, os.pardir) or
   145             pycompat.ossep in part or
   145             pycompat.ossep in part or
   146             os.altsep is not None and os.altsep in part):
   146             pycompat.osaltsep is not None and pycompat.osaltsep in part):
   147             return
   147             return
   148     fpath = os.path.join(*parts)
   148     fpath = os.path.join(*parts)
   149     if isinstance(directory, str):
   149     if isinstance(directory, str):
   150         directory = [directory]
   150         directory = [directory]
   151     for d in directory:
   151     for d in directory: